CAR ACCIDENT: Passenger killed in DUI collision

Mar. 8, 2010

Oakland – An intoxicated driver run a red light and crashed into another car, killing its passenger, in an intersection near Oakland International Airport, Saturday evening.

According to officer Jeff Thomason, the drunk driver was in his Ford F-150 pickup heading east in Doolittle Drive when he run a red light at Hegenberger Road, and then collided with a red 2007 Pontiac G6, at around 5:30 p.m.

The 43-year-old Oakland man who was aboard the Pontiac was found dead on the spot, while the driver, a 27-year-old Richmond woman suffered non-life-threatening injuries and was taken to a hospital for treatment.

The driver of the pickup, who was suspected of DUI was hospitalized with non-life-threatening injuries.

Thomason says officers also discovered a large quantity of marijuana in the pickup.
